LARP Remember Their Fathers The joy of putting together on a daily basis is the opportunity to get to know Los Angeles Radio People better than how they are perceived in the radio world. From time to time I have initiated special features that allow us to peek into their lives. In , I asked LARP to talk about their Fathers. George Green George Green was with KABC for over 35 years. He is now a talent agent, author and radio station consultant. George shares a memory about his father. "I have great memories of my father who was a famous barber in Hollywood as I was growing up. He worked at Sy Devore's barber shop, which was right across the street from NBC where I was working as a page while going through UCLA. He was an amateur songwriter and had 20 major songs published including artists like Peggy Lee and Herb Alpert. He worked his butt off 6 days a week and devoted most of his life to his family. Work ethics and discipline was his motto and I learned that from him. Unfortunately, he worked too hard and never did enjoy the fruits of his labor. The lesson here is everything in moderation: WORK • Espuelas returns to Univision in LA radio revampFernando Espuelas returns to Univision as part of a programming revamp of the companys L.A. talk radio station KTNQ AM. El Show de Fernando Espuelas, which aired nationwide for seven years, was one of several original AM talk shows canceled by Univision Radio in At the time, the radio network restructuring led to local stations airing targeted local content that was mostly paid programming. There have been some original shows slowly added to the local station lineup over the past couple of years, such as En Boca de León, which debuted in Espuelas show will be shorter than its previous run just one hour, not two and will air at 3 pm PT in a later timeslot than before. (At the time of its cancellation, the show aired from pm ET/11 am-1 pm PT.) Univision Los Angeles announced today the new programming slate for KTNQ AM, which will cover sports, community empowerment, politics, health and personal finance.
